Katherine passing out bananas. Each monk has an alms bowl that they take out every morning to get food from the regular folk. On this day, the regular folk come to them, and put a bit of food into each bowl. Then the food is all collected and the monks eat later that morning. Any left over food is given away later in the day. Judging by the number of people giving food, I think there must have been plenty of leftovers.
